全部產品
Search
文件中心

PolarDB:管理Orca串連地址

更新時間:Mar 29, 2025

本文為您介紹如何管理PolarDB MySQL版的Orca串連地址。

預設地址與自訂地址說明

地址類型

地址說明

適用情境

預設地址

建立PolarDB MySQL版叢集時,勾選是否開啟Orca後,每個叢集將會分配一個預設的Orca串連地址。該地址的服務由資料庫代理提供。

預設Orca串連地址支援自動讀寫分離,即寫請求會被路由到主節點,讀請求則會被路由到唯讀節點。關於資料庫代理的詳細說明,請參見資料庫代理

適用於具有讀寫分離需求的業務,並且可通過增加唯讀節點來實現快速、即時的業務擴充。

自訂地址

PolarDB MySQL版支援建立Orca自訂串連地址,這些地址的服務由資料庫代理提供。

  • 自訂地址可以配置讀寫入模式及負載平衡策略,既可支援讀寫分離,也可支援純唯讀業務。詳細的配置請參見設定資料庫代理

  • 自訂地址最少能夠掛載一個唯讀節點,通過這個地址的請求只會到達這個唯讀節點。

  • 通過自訂地址,可以實現不同業務對資料庫節點進行訪問隔離的需求。

  • 通過將讀寫入模式配置為唯讀,可以實現該地址僅支援純唯讀業務。

說明

列存索引(IMCI)節點不支援Orca功能,所以Orca的串連地址無法被路由到列存索引(IMCI)節點

建立Orca自訂串連地址

  1. 登入PolarDB控制台

  2. 在左側導覽列單擊叢集列表

  3. 在左上方,選擇叢集所在地區。

  4. 找到目的地組群,單擊叢集ID。

  5. 在叢集基本信息頁面的資料庫連接地區,單擊创建自定义地址,選擇地址類型Orca地址,自訂串連名稱,並設定資料庫代理相關的功能。具體請參見設定資料庫代理image

    說明
    • 地址類型需選擇Orca地址

    • Orca地址中,代理項负载均衡设置僅限於负载均衡策略主库是否接受读的配置,一致性设置則僅限於一致性级别的配置。無法進行连接池设置HTAP最佳化安全防護的配置。

修改Orca串連地址

  1. 登入PolarDB控制台

  2. 在左側導覽列單擊叢集列表

  3. 在左上方,選擇叢集所在地區。

  4. 找到目的地組群,單擊叢集ID。

  5. 在叢集基本信息頁面的資料庫連接地區,找到目標地址,單擊目標地址中私網公網右側的image>編輯來修改串連地址。imageimage

重要
  • 串連地址首碼需滿足如下條件:

    • 由小寫字母、數字、中劃線(-)組成,6~40個字元。

    • 以小寫字母開頭,以數字或字母結尾。

  • 連接埠範圍為3000~5999。

  • 如果該串連地址正在啟用SSL,修改會導致叢集重啟。

  • 如果該串連地址正在啟用SSL,則修改後的串連地址全長不能超過64個字元。

釋放Orca串連地址

重要
  • 釋放串連地址前,請確保您的應用程式已經更新為新的串連地址進行訪問。

  • 串連地址一經釋放,將無法恢複,只能重新建立。

  1. 登入PolarDB控制台

  2. 在左側導覽列單擊叢集列表

  3. 在左上方,選擇叢集所在地區。

  4. 找到目的地組群,單擊叢集ID。

  5. 在叢集基本信息頁面的資料庫連接地區,找到目標地址,點擊目標地址右上方釋放來釋放串連地址。image

  6. 在彈出的對話方塊中,單擊確定